> I run an Intel(R) Xeon(R) CPU E5520 @ 2.27GHz and follow, apart from perf
> list, this list
> <http://oprofile.sourceforge.net/docs/intel-corei7-events.php>for the
> available counters.
> Based on Linux perf events Event Sources
> <http://www.brendangregg.com/perf.html> I expected that counters like
>
> MEM_STORE_RETIRED and MEM_LOAD_RETIRED
>
> would capture only DRAM's activity. I mean that if I don't use DRAM it's
> bizarre to me to see these counters have the same trend with CPI and other
> cpu counters. I run a cpu intensive benchmark which does not use DRAM, as I
> could see from htop, and these two counters followed the same trend, in the
> graph that I created later, with almost all the other counters. So, my
> question is if there are any counters which are "triggered" only when I use
> DRAM?
> Like the IO_TRANSACTIONS which is triggered only when I have I/Os.
